About the role
The Supervisor, Project Accounting will oversee project accounting activities, ensuring accuracy and compliance with financial policies and procedures.
Responsibilities
- Oversee project accounting activities, including budgeting, forecasting, and financial reporting for assigned projects.
- Ensure compliance with financial policies and procedures, and provide guidance on financial matters to project teams.
- Prepare and analyze financial reports, including variance analysis, to support decision-making processes.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ure accurate and timely financial data is provided to stakeholders.
- Manage project budgets, monitor expenditures, and make adjustments as necessary to maintain financial alignment with project goals.
- Develop and maintain strong relationships with project managers and other finance team members to facilitate effective communication and collaboration.
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, or a related field.
- Minimum 5 years of relevant experience in project accounting or financial management.
- Experience working in a fast-paced, dynamic environment with multiple projects simultaneously.
- Strong analytical skills and the ability to manage multiple tasks and priorities effectively.
- Proficiency in financial software and tools, such as QuickBooks, Microsoft Excel, and project management systems.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work collaboratively with diverse teams.
Qualifications
- CPA certification preferred but not required.
- Knowledge of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P).
- Experience with financial modeling and budgeting.
- Understanding of project management methodologies and tools.
